D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Industrial field of application] The present invention smoothly turns left when a vehicle starts from a parking state in which the vehicle is tilted with respect to a side wall, such as a garage, without the side surface of the vehicle contacting the side wall. Or you can turn right,
The present invention relates to a steering angle ratio control device for a four-wheel steering vehicle.

[Prior Art] In a four-wheel steering vehicle, if the rear wheels are steered in the opposite phase to the front wheels,
The turning radius is reduced, and the turning performance is improved. However, compared to conventional front-wheel steering vehicles, the range of motion in the rear corners of the vehicle is wider, and if there are obstacles such as side walls on the side of the track (hereinafter referred to as side walls), the rear corners of the vehicle at the time of turning are changed. May come into contact with the side wall.

In order to solve the above-mentioned problem, in a four-wheel steering vehicle disclosed in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 61-27767, when the steering wheel is greatly turned, the rear wheel steering angle is gradually changed to a target steering angle every predetermined traveling distance. Approach the corner. However, in the above-described four-wheel steering vehicle, the yaw angle (the inclination angle of the front-rear axis of the vehicle with respect to the side wall) also changes stepwise in accordance with the rear-wheel steering angle, so that the movement of the vehicle becomes very unnatural and driving Person feels uncomfortable.

In the rear wheel steering control device disclosed in JP-A-62-120275, as shown in FIG. 8, when the vehicle starts, the turning center of the vehicle 44 is previously determined from the front wheel steering angle θF and the rear wheel steering angle θR. Q is calculated, the distance between the turning center Q and the rear corner R of the vehicle 44, that is, the turning radius Ro is calculated, and the overhang amount s1 of the rear corner R accompanying the turning of the vehicle is calculated.
The steering angle ratio is controlled so that the overhang amount s1 does not become larger than the gap so between the side surface of the vehicle 44 and the side wall 80.

[Operation] In the present invention, when the vehicle starts, the front and rear wheel steering angles and the respective distances between the left and right sidewalls and the front and rear wheel supporting portions of the vehicle are detected, and the vehicle from the respective distances of the front and rear wheel supporting portions of the vehicle to the left and right sidewalls is detected. Each yaw angle (the inclination of the longitudinal axis of the vehicle with respect to the left and right side walls) is calculated, and the maximum rear wheel when turning to the left and turning left so that the front wheel steering angle is maximum and the vehicle does not touch the side wall from the yaw angle and distance. The steering angle ratios are controlled so as not to exceed the smaller one of the maximum rear wheel steering angles, that is, the maximum rear wheel steering angle of which the rear corners of the vehicle have a small protrusion amount. As a result, the steering angle ratio continuously changes with the steering of the driver without the rear corners of the vehicle coming into contact with the side wall, and smooth turning travel is realized.

According to the present invention, when the vehicle starts or when the vehicle turns around a narrow road, the rear corner R of the vehicle is pushed out of the road and comes into contact with the side wall 80 by the rear wheel steering in a phase opposite to that of the front wheel 2. In order to prevent this, the steering angle ratio k is limited to the minimum steering angle ratio kL (negative value). In other words, from the front and rear wheel steering angles θF, θR to the turning radius
While obtaining Ro, the initial yaw angles ψL, ψR (the inclination angle of the front-rear axis of the vehicle with respect to the left and right side walls 80) are calculated from the distances sF, sR between the front and rear wheel supports and the turning center Q of the side walls 80 and the vehicle. Is calculated, and the turning radius Ro of the vehicle is determined by the turning center Q and the side wall.
Limit rudder angle ratio to a value that does not exceed 80
Control kL. In this case, the limit rudder ratios kLL and kLR for the left-turn and the right-turn of the vehicle are calculated, and the larger value is used as the limit rudder ratio. The turning center is obtained from the front wheel steering angle θF, the rear wheel steering angle θR, and the yaw angle ψ. The turning radius Ro is the distance between the rear corner R of the vehicle and the turning center Q.

As shown in FIG. 5, according to the present invention, two pairs of front and rear distance sensors 62a and 62b, which are arranged adjacent to the front and rear wheel supporting portions of the vehicle and detect a distance by reflected waves of ultrasonic waves, and a front and rear wheel steering angle sensor 5 are provided.
Based on the signals of 9,60, the electronic control unit 51 controls the minimum rear wheel steering angle θ so that the rear corners of the vehicle do not contact the left and right side walls 80.
RLmin and θRRmin are obtained, and the steering angle ratio kL is controlled so as not to exceed the minimum rear wheel steering angle θRmin, whichever has the smaller absolute value.

On the other hand, in normal traveling, the steering angle ratio k is controlled according to the vehicle speed V (see FIG. 4). For example, based on a signal from a vehicle speed sensor 55 arranged facing the output shaft of the transmission, an electronic control unit
The steering angle ratio k corresponding to the vehicle speed is obtained by the steering angle ratio setting means 51, and the steering angle ratio control means 18 drives the steering angle ratio control motor 18 with the steering angle ratio k as the target steering angle ratio kt. And the partial gear 22
The steering angle ratio control motor 18 is stopped when the actual steering angle ratio ks detected by the steering angle ratio sensor 56 arranged opposite to the target steering angle ratio kt matches the target steering angle ratio kt.

Since the steering angle ratio is continuously controlled, the rear wheel steering angle also changes continuously, and the driver does not feel uncomfortable.The rear wheel steering angle is limited to a predetermined value or less, so Even if the steering wheel is turned to the maximum with the same feeling as in a front-wheel steering vehicle, the side surface of the vehicle can be prevented from coming into contact with the side wall.
